The global biological safety testing products and services market was valued at approximately USD 4.57 billion in 2023 and is anticipated to expand at a CAGR of 10.7% over the forecast period 2024-2032. Increasing demand for biologics, vaccines, and gene therapy products has propelled the need for stringent safety evaluations, fostering the adoption of biological safety testing solutions. As regulatory authorities impose rigorous safety standards for pharmaceutical and biopharmaceutical products, the demand for innovative testing methodologies is increasing.
Biological safety testing ensures that pharmaceutical and biologics manufacturing processes remain free from contamination. Rising government funding and private investments in drug development, coupled with the expansion of biotechnology and pharmaceutical industries, have further boosted the adoption of advanced biological safety testing methods. Companies are prioritizing regulatory compliance to mitigate risks associated with microbial contamination, residual host-cell proteins, and endotoxin levels. For instance, in 2023, Charles River Laboratories expanded its safety testing capabilities with enhanced in vitro testing solutions, catering to the evolving needs of biopharmaceutical developers.
Furthermore, the growing focus on personalized medicine and gene therapies has necessitated advanced biological safety testing protocols. The rise in cell-based therapies and monoclonal antibodies (mAbs) has heightened concerns regarding product integrity, sterility, and safety. Regulatory bodies such as the FDA, EMA, and WHO have implemented stringent guidelines requiring robust biological safety testing at various stages of development and manufacturing. Technological advancements, including CRISPR-based testing methods and next-generation sequencing (NGS), have further enhanced testing accuracy and efficiency.
Despite these positive trends, high costs associated with biological safety testing instruments and services remain a challenge for small and mid-sized biopharmaceutical firms. However, ongoing technological advancements, the emergence of AI-driven biosafety solutions, and the increasing integration of automated testing platforms are expected to reduce operational costs over time. Additionally, market players are focusing on expanding their service portfolios through acquisitions and strategic partnerships. In January 2023, Thermo Fisher Scientific acquired a major stake in a biosafety testing service provider to enhance its global presence and strengthen its regulatory compliance capabilities.
